You might try running M1 synthetic 10w-40(high mile formula), I find it does well even with the winters in WA. It was one of the oils our 3.0 did not want to consume or push out through seals/gaskets.
As far as AC, re-man AC units can be pricey but might be worth the investment with the summer heat. It will probably need to be converted from R12-to the more friendly(and available) R-134 along with a fresh receiver/dryer unit. If I had to estimate, it would probably run $500-1k at an indie.
